1 / 2 drát LCD a klávesnice řidiče

o ano, na manuál, specifikuje 4x4 klávesnice s posledním sloupci jako 'A' písmen 'B', 'C' a 'D', jako 'D' jako tlačítko VALID, jak jste se vyjádřil 3x4keypad, chybí poslední sloupec, byl 'D' tlačítko mimo označené jako platný. Nyní musíte stisknout 'D' (uppercase! nezapomeňte!) poslat na tlačítko PLATNÝ ... S trochou trpělivosti funguje to dobře, jsem se dostal na změnu hesla, nastavení plochy a nastavit budík ... (Nezapomeňte uvést heslo a 'prázdné' tlačítko '1111-'nebo acept údaje pomocí tlačítka PLATNÝ' velká písmena D '), budu se pustili do práce na terminálu pro tento projetc, já jsem v plánu použít PIC16f628 OR PIC16F88 dejte mi vědět Který z nich vám vyhovuje, nebo máte po ruce, nebo může dostat snadno ... (Tye ol '16F84 je příliš starý na práci ... eficient potřebovat jeden s integrovaným USART ...) kontrolu listech ... moje práce by bylo docela jednodušší než s 16F628 16F88, takže pokud můžete získat oba, dovolte mi vybrat 16F628, tak budu čekat na vaši odpověď ...
 
ano, vypadá všechno v pořádku teď, když touží pracovat s 16f28A prosím, jsem si jist, můžu dostat. Ještě jednou díky, já se těším na to vidět.
 
takže ... toto je můj pokus o semi-exkluzivní terminál sériovým LCD + klávesnice ... to odlišuje od běžného charakteru k goto-příkaz na MSbit ... Promiň, že jsem to udělal na C (s velkým CC5x), ale připojený vygenerovaný ASM souboru ... Navrhuji získat CC5x, pokud potřebujete provést další změny ... s virtuální terminál funguje to skvěle ... Nyní se spojit ... musí změnit řádek o postupu LCDOUT, nechcete-li "Enter" přes TX, ale přesný příkaz goto ... doufejme, že budu dělat to na další hodiny ... Pokud je vše v pořádku, to bude fungovat bez problémů ... více [Url = http://images.elektroda.net/9_1277740789.jpg]
9_1277740789_thumb.jpg
[/url] krystal je hodnota 4MHz ... stejně ... se stejným init postup, měly by být obě křišťálové být stejnou hodnotu! Také! ladění linka musí být z této programu terminálu, takže není echo na terminálu ....
 
cool, zapomněl říct, já jsem s použitím klávesnice 4x4
 
oh! Stačí připojit 4-tého sloupce D4 diody .. kód byl pro 4x4 klávesnice stejně ... [Size = 2] [color = # 999999] Přidáno po 5 hodin 52 minut: [/color] [/size] ok, tak daleko, i upravený terminál kód být rychlejší, a upravil hlavní alarm programu ... tak toto je somekind beta verze ... To má problémy speciálně s waitpress a waitrelease postupy ... ale funguje to somelike ... Zkouška se ... [Url = http://images.elektroda.net/7_1277764696.gif]
7_1277764696_thumb.gif
[/url], aby to fungovalo na Proteus jsem musel upravit obvod málo, většinou vypnout nepoužívané věci a dělal všechny odpor digitální sim .... Doufám, že si mohl postavit, a test to více, že jsem v úmyslu udělat vše pro sériovou komunikaci o přerušení, takže to nebude mít žádný větší problémy při čtení klávesnice .... v době, kdy mi říct, jak to funguje u vás ... (Heslo je '1111 'znovu)
 
to je v pohodě kámo, objednal jsem si 16f28A, jakmile jste mi řekl. tak jsem měl dostat ji 2 / 3 dny max. Mezitím jsem si všechno kabelové a když jsem dostal ic budu dělat terminálu. Takže bych řekl, budete vědět, o 2 / 3 dny. Vím, že tam je trochu problém s waitpress a waitrelease postupy, s druhým poslední, musím zkontrolovat novou dnes, nemohl jsem se dostat pasivní režim stisknutím tlačítka # na klávesnici s poslední. Pokud měníte ve střední době, dejte mi prosím vědět. Pokusím se simulátor vidět, jak funguje její ...
 
dobře udělal vole, bych měl dostat terminálu se brzy, ať víte, pak:. D jen přemýšlel, když alarm aktivní zvon / blesk Předpokládám, že se zhasne? dotírat vidět je pracovat v simulátoru.
 

Welcome to EDABoard.com

Sponsor

Back
Top